9+ A BILL TO BE ENTITLED
410 AN ACT
511 relating to eligibility requirements to hold a political party
612 office.
713 BE IT ENACTED BY THE LEGISLATURE OF THE STATE OF TEXAS:
814 SECTION 1. Section 161.005, Election Code, is amended by
915 amending Subsections (a) and (c) and adding Subsection (a-1) to
1016 read as follows:
1117 (a) To be eligible to be a candidate for or to serve as an
1218 officer [a county or precinct chair] of a political party, a person
1319 must:
1420 (1) [be a qualified voter of the county; and
1521 [(2)] except as provided by Subsection (c), not be a
1622 candidate for nomination or election to, or be the holder of, an
1723 elective office of the federal, state, or county government; and
1824 (2) if the office is a county or precinct chair of a
1925 political party, be a qualified voter of the county.
2026 (a-1) For purposes of this section, the following are
21- officers of a political party:
22- (1) a precinct chair;
23- (2) a county chair; and
24- (3) a member, a chair, or a vice chair of a state
25- executive committee of a political party.
27+ officers of a political party: precinct chair, county chair, and a
28+ member, vice chair, and chair of a state executive committee of a
29+ political party.
2630 (c) A candidate for nomination or election to, or the holder
2731 of, an elective office of the federal, state, or county government
2832 is eligible to serve as an officer [a county or precinct chair] of a
2933 political party to which Chapter 181 applies.
